Class 3 Error

SYMPTOM:
A multiphase case (with at least two Eulerian phases) which has a Lagrangian particle phase which transfers mass to an Eulerian phase and uses the coupled volume fraction method for its solution gives incorrect results. The results are correct if the Eulerian fluid involved in mass transfer from the Lagrangian particles has a density of exactly 1 in solver units, but incorrect otherwise. In a well-converged case, it may be noticed that the imbalances of some equations (those which have a contribution from the Particle Source) are significantly larger than for the other equations, but for a less well-converged case this will not be noticeable.

WORKAROUND:
No workaround is currently available.

FIXED IN:
ANSYS CFX Release 12.0. A custom executable for ANSYS CFX 11.0 SP1 is available on request.
